Cable displays use pairs of thin steel cables to hold posters and other images. These cable systems can be used to create a neat and sleek display, where the images seem to be suspended in mid-air. Commonly used for window displays, cable displays can also be used against a wall. As well as displaying posters and images, cable displays can hold digital screens, illuminated panels, literature holders, and other components. A flexible modular system, cable displays can be expanded and tailored to your space and requirements.

Cable displays have pairs of parallel cables that are strung vertically between two surfaces. One of the benefits of this type of display is that the fixing brackets can be attached to a wall, ceiling, floor, or a combination of the two. For example, for a window display, you can string cables from the floor of the window area to either the ceiling or to a 90Āŗ bracket on the wall above the window. The ability to attach cables to floors/ceilings or walls makes it possible to create displays of the exact size you want.
The basic installation technique is to measure and mark where you want your cables at the top connection point. Then, using a plum line to get a perfect vertical, mark the bottom positions. The cable fixings are attached using screws, so anyone with a drill and basic DIY skills can carry out the installation. Once the wall fixings and cables are in place, you can attach your poster pockets and other components to the cables. This is done with panel clamps that are tightened with an allen key. The panel clamps can be single- or double-sided and come in two sizes: small (for panels up to 4mm thick) and large (for panels up to 8mm thick).

Digital panels can be integrated into your cable display, offering instant updating and the ability to show video and multiple images on each panel. These are a popular tool for estate agent windows, where they can show hi-res photos and video clips of properties.
Literature holders can be included as part of a cable display system to store leaflets, brochures, and other promotional documents. These are a popular option for retail displays, showrooms, and exhibitions.

When planning your cable display, an important consideration is the size of images you want to show. Poster pockets and panels are available in a range of standard formats including A0, A1, A2, A3, A4, and A5. There is also a choice of portrait or landscape orientation pockets for most sizes. You may want to have posters of all one size, while combinations of different sized images can make a window display more dynamic and visually interesting.
Another decision is the spacing between images. Images can be positioned in a continuous wall, with double-sided clamps letting poster pockets share cables. Alternatively, you may want to have a more spread out display with spaces between the images.
Cable displays can be bought in kits that include cables, fixings, and poster pockets, or you can buy components separately to create a bespoke set up. A benefit of kits is that they give you everything you need in a single package, often at a better price than purchasing the individual components separately. However, if you know the exact number of parts and components you need for your display, buying the elements separately may be the better option. Many people start off by buying a kit and then add extra components as needed.
